Output 682eb0459a019632902e2fbb9c886aee5b2acd0fa6df2d97ab2f112b1f8e5c63:1

value
18611368484
script pubkey
OP_0 OP_PUSHBYTES_20 d940e37cb261c27575549ba601e1e0314c920c2c
address
ltc1qm9qwxl9jv8p82a25nwnqrc0qx9xfyrpvxyt3th
transaction
682eb0459a019632902e2fbb9c886aee5b2acd0fa6df2d97ab2f112b1f8e5c63
spent
true